Research On Distribution Characteristics Of The Submerged Plants And Its Environmental Impact Factors In Some Wetlands Of Poyang Lake

This paper choose Nanjishan、Baishazhou、Longkou and Wucheng wetland of the Poyang Lake as the research area. By periodic investigation in all the year round,the paper studies the species, distribution and community structure of submerged plant in Poyang Lake. And the study collects water samples and sediment samples to measure main environmental factors of soil and water by laboratory experiments analysis. The paper also studies the temporal and spatial variations of water and sediment samples of environmental factors according to the characteristics of different lakes in different seasons; and discusses the key environmental factors that affects the growth and distribution of submerged plant in different seasons using CCA based on data of the submerged plant species abundance and soil environmental factors; Finally, some suggestions and countermeasures about the recovery and protection of the submerged plant are put forward according to the results. The main conclusions are as follows:(1)Twelve species of submerged plants were recorded in wetland in Poyang Lake. They are distributed in 6 families, 8 genera. Nanjishan wetland distributes all kinds of typical submerged plants. The Hydrilla verticillata and Vallisneria natans are the dominant species, and also widely distributed species, which appeared in the whole investigation area. then the widely distributed species are followed by Najas minor, which is widely ditributed in the Nanjisan wetland. Hydrilla verticillata and Vallisneria natans have strong environment adaptability and can be selected as the pioneer species for submerged vegetation recovery engineering work.(2) The submerged plant of Poyang Lake wetland in spring are clustering analyzed by two-way indicator species sorting method(TWINSPAN), they can be divided into six associations: Hydrilla verticillata+ Vallisneria natans group, Najasminor + Vallisneria natans group, Ottelia alismoides group, Potamogeton crispus group, Ceratophyllum demersum group, Vallisneria spinulosa group.(3) The water environmental factors of typical wetland in Poyang Lake are different in time and space. The results show that: the Total Nitrogen(ρ(TN)) showed a rule that,winter > spring > summer > autumn; Total Phosphorus(ρ(TP)), spring >autumn > winter > summer; Chemical Oxygen Demand(ρ(COD)), autumn > spring >winter > summer, Dissolved Oxygen(ρ(DO)),winter > spring > autumn > summer.The water environment factors change are not consistent in different lakes even though in the same season. In the spring, ρ(TN) of Bang Lake in Wu Cheng is the highest, reached(1.262±0.776 mg/L), the maximum value of ρ(TP) is in Longkou,ρ(COD) of Nanjishan is at the top, ρ(DO) in Bang lake of Wu Cheng is the highest; in the summer, the highest content of ρ(TN) is in Longkou, as(0.937 ± 0.304) mg/L, the highest value of ρ(TP) is still in Longkou, maximum of ρ(COD) is in Zhushi lake in Wucheng town, ρ(DO) of Baisha Lake in Nanjishan Wetland is the highest. In the autumn, ρ(TN) of Bang Lake in Wucheng is the highest, for(0.383 ± 0.042 mg/L,maximum of ρ(TP) is still in Longkou, the highest content of ρ(COD) appears in Bang Lake of Wu Cheng, highest content of ρ(DO) is in Zhushi Lake of Wu Cheng; In winter, highest total nitrogen content is in Zhushi Lake of Wucheng Town, for(3.914± 0.769 mg/L, ρ(TP) and ρ(COD) in Dahuchi in Wucheng are the highest, ρ((DO) of Changhu Lake often as the highest.(4) Seasonal change rule of Total Nitrogen and Total Phosphorus in the sediment is consistent, the highest Total Nitrogen(w(TN))is in the spring, with the Total Nitrogen value of(0.080±0.035 mg/g) and Total Phosphorus( w(TP)) value of(0.630-0.020 mg/g),while they are falling down in the summer and autumns, when in the winter,the Total Nitrogen and Total Phosphorus are between in summer and autumn. But when it comes to the total organic carbonw w(TOC), the highest value is in summer, with the value of(1.452 ± 0.680) mg/g, and the lowest. Appears in autumn. From the aspect of different lakes, in spring, the highest value of w(TN),w(TP) and w(TOC) are all in Nanjishan, and the change tendency of three sediment indexes is consistent; in summer, change tendency of w(TN)and w(TOC)is consistent,Wu Cheng > Nanjishan> Longkou >Baishazhou, the maximum value of w(TP)is in Longkou, and there is little difference among other lakes, with the same distribution trend as w(TP)in water; in autumn, except to the Zhushi Lake of Wu Cheng, the difference of the three sediment indexes in other lakes is not obvious; in winter,w(TN)、w(TP)and w(TOC)in Zhushihu are the highest, while in Dahuchi is the lowest.(5) The analysis results of Model corresponding(CCA) reflect that: The impact on submerged plants of different environmental factors in different seasons is different. In spring, all the water and soil environmental factors have significantly effects on submerged plants, especially the depth of the water(D), total phosphorus of sediment w(TP), p H, water temperature(T) and water transparency(Trans); in summer,effects of environmental factors on submerged plant are not same, the main factors are the water transparency(Trans), total nitrogen of water ρ(TN), p H and temperature(T);in autumn, the environmental factors, such as the dissolved oxygen ρ(DO), total phosphorus of water ρ(TP), sediment organic carbon w(TOC) and water transparency(Trans), all have influence on the submerged plant; in winter, the difference of the environmental factors influence is obvious, the key influence factors are total phosphorus of water ρ(TP), total nitrogen of sediment w(TN)and water transparency(Trans).
